Early Life and Education

Andrea Pyle was born on November 16, 1972, in Houston, Texas, to Linda and Frank Pyle. Her family later moved to Tennessee, where she grew up in a large brood with two older sisters (Debbie and Julie), two older brothers (Sam and Paul), a younger half-brother (Gordon), and a half-sister (Meredith). Pyle attended Germantown High School in Germantown, Tennessee, and graduated from the North Carolina School of the Arts in 1995.

Acting Career

Pyle's acting career began with a small role in "As Good as It Gets" (1997). Her breakout role came as Gwen DeMarco in "Galaxy Quest" (1999). She went on to star in films such as "Bringing Down the House" (2003), "Home Alone 4" (2002), "Charlie and the Chocolate Factory" (2005), and "Dodgeball" (2004), in which she played the lead role. Pyle has also appeared in television shows such as "Heroes," "Boston Legal," and "The Sarah Silverman Program."

Music Career

In addition to her acting, Pyle is an accomplished country singer. She is a member of the country-rock group Smith & Pyle, which she formed with actress Shawnee Smith. In 2008, they released their debut album, "It's OK to Be Happy," on their own label, Urban Prairie Records.

Personal Life

On September 12, 2008, Pyle married Casey Anderson, a National Geographic bear specialist. The wedding ceremony took place in Montana and was attended by one of Anderson's bears, Brutus, as well as Smith. Pyle currently resides in Montana and continues to act and pursue her music career.
